Handover note — calendar sync

Hey folks, quick context before I'm out: the Petrel sync worker keeps hitting conflicts when a recurring event is edited on both sides within the debounce window. I bumped the conflict resolver to last-writer-wins for single instances but series edits still need manual review. Marit has the half-finished patch. If you need to reproduce, the staging worker runs with these settings.

service settings:
PRAIX_LOG_LEVEL=error
PRAIX_METRICS_HOST=metrics.praix.qorvelcorp.corp
PRAIX_POOL_SIZE=16

Pattern so far: failures cluster around the nightly analytics window, suggesting pool exhaustion on the shared `lintcheck` database rather than a network fault. Please confirm max connections on that instance, check whether the linter is leaking sessions between files, and capture `pg_stat_activity` output during a failure. To reproduce locally, point the linter at the database using the string below.

primary connection of yagep-kahip = redis://giliel_svc:zYiKsLL2PLpfPL@db-348f.xolmarsys.corp:5432/fenwyn

Alert: version skew detected in the Larkspur shared component library. One or more consuming apps are pinned to a major version two or more releases behind the published baseline, which means breaking style and accessibility fixes are not propagating. This alert fires nightly after the Dunmore registry sync. Check which apps are lagging, confirm whether the pin is intentional (some teams freeze before release weeks), and file an upgrade ticket if not. The skew dashboard and the current exemption list are available here.

operations page: https://jenkins.zemvarcloud.local/job/merge_requests/repo/build/73930b4b30f0a8ed

## Releases

Quick note for the sync: the nightly search reindex on Mossgate now ships as its own release artifact instead of piggybacking on the API deploy. It runs at 01:30, takes ~20 minutes, and rolls back automatically on checksum mismatch. Artifacts must be signed before the runner will touch them. The key we sign reindex artifacts with is below.

release key, bagep-yajof: bky19_xtqFhCW5hRYj5CXT2ZJ